What did Thor sacrifice?
Facing Ragnarok, Thor sought out the immeasurable power of the Odinpower to stop Asgard from being destroyed. However, to gain his fallen father’s extraordinary abilities, Thor made a great sacrifice as he gave both his eyes (and eventually his life) to become Rune King Thor.

Why did Thor sacrifice his eyes?
Thor, desperate to gain more power and to stop the Ragnarok, finds the Well of Wisdom. In order to ascend to a new plane of power, Thor must make a sacrifice. So he rips out both of his eyes and plunges them into the water.

Why did Odin sacrifice himself?
But he wanted to know everything and gain wisdom and knowledge of things hidden from him. This was a desire that drove him to sacrifice himself. He then hanged himself in Yggdrasil, the tree of life, for nine days and nine nights in order to gain knowledge of other worlds and be able to understand the runes.

What happened to Thor in the Marvel Universe?
As a consequence of the ” Heroes Reborn ” crossover story arc of the 1990s, Thor was removed from mainstream Marvel continuity and with other Marvel characters re-imagined in an alternate universe for one year.
When did Thor first appear in the comics?
Thor (Marvel Comics) Debuting in the Silver Age of Comic Books, the character first appeared in Journey into Mystery #83 (August 1962) and was created by penciller-plotter Jack Kirby, editor-plotter Stan Lee, and scripter Larry Lieber.
